Featuring a 7.62x39mm caliber and a robust gas piston action, the MAK-90 is a civilian adaptation of the storied AK-47, tailored for compliance with rigorous U.S. firearms regulations. This model's history as a modified AK-1990 ('MAK-90') reflects its adaptation post-1989 U.S. import restrictions, offering a fascinating insight into firearm legislation and engineering adaptability. The MAK-90 Sporter's blued finish not only enhances its resistance to corrosion but also adds to its sleek, traditional look. The integrated sighting system, featuring a hooded adjustable front sight and a height-adjustable rear sight, aids in accurate targeting.
